
The IRt/c.03 has similarities to the IRt/c.01, but is designed with a narrower field of view. Due to its small size and threaded housing, this model is also easy to mount and install. It finds its use in applications with low ambient temperatures (max 70°C) including agriculture and laminating.

The Micro IRt/c.4SV is a unique sensor with some very specific advantages. As well as its very small size, it has a right-angle measurement for use in confined spaces, built-in airpurge for cooling and cleaning, and a very small spot. This model has a narrow field of view of 14° to measure targets at larger distances. Suitable for temperatures of above 200°C (392°F), the micro IRt/c.4SV is popular in applications in medical and mining. Mounting brackets are available as accessories.
The IRt/c.3X is one of our most popular sensors. It has a specialized detector with high sensitivity, allowing it to be used across a broad temperature range, from -50°C right up to 650°C. With its built-in airpurge, it can be used in harsh environments and has a proven track record in challenging applications. Examples include heavy industry, oil and gas, mining, transport, drying and curing.
The IRt/c.1X is very similar to the IRt/c, and equals its reliability and robustness. With a threaded housing for easy mounting and installation, this model is used in many fields, including robotics, (3D) printing, drying and curing processes.
